        hi m8, get yourself a 90cm/100cm dish, usals motor/lnb/wall mount and for a receiver it depends on what you want. if you want basically plug and play then take a look at the spiderbox/protek which both do sd and hd versions although there is a 12 month time limit on the "gift" connection with the spiderbox. if you want to have a play and set a c/s system up yourself then have a look at the dm600/800 or tm600/800 sd and hd versions. you can get yourself a motorised dish pack for between ?120 and ?200 depending on quality and then receivers are between ?100 and ?400.
        do alot of reading on the net concerning c/s and the equipment needed but we cant talk about it on dk as its a bit dodgy. take your time and look at the pro,s and con,s of each system and its cost then make your choice and if you need any help "when" you get stuck just ask on here and someone will help you. regards mdt
